Find out which car is the better choice for you – CUPRA Born or Toyota Corolla Cross?
Price and efficiency are key factors when choosing a car – and this is often where the real differences emerge.
Toyota Corolla Cross has a barely noticeable advantage in terms of price – it starts at 31700 £, while the CUPRA Born costs 34700 £. That’s a price difference of around 2966 £.
Power, torque and acceleration say a lot about how a car feels on the road. This is where you see which model delivers more driving dynamics.
When it comes to engine power, the CUPRA Born has a convincingly edge – offering 326 HP compared to 180 HP. That’s roughly 146 HP more horsepower.
In acceleration from 0 to 100 km/h, the CUPRA Born is evident quicker – completing the sprint in 5.60 s, while the Toyota Corolla Cross takes 7.60 s. That’s about 2 s faster.
In terms of top speed, the CUPRA Born performs barely noticeable better – reaching 200 km/h, while the Toyota Corolla Cross tops out at 180 km/h. The difference is around 20 km/h.
Beyond pure performance, interior space and usability matter most in daily life. This is where you see which car is more practical and versatile.
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.
In curb weight, Toyota Corolla Cross is noticeable lighter – 1380 kg compared to 1828 kg. The difference is around 448 kg.
In terms of boot space, the Toyota Corolla Cross offers slight more room – 425 L compared to 385 L. That’s a difference of about 40 L.
In maximum load capacity, the Toyota Corolla Cross performs hardly perceptible better – up to 1337 L, which is about 70 L more than the CUPRA Born.
When it comes to payload, Toyota Corolla Cross slightly takes the win – 560 kg compared to 452 kg. That’s a difference of about 108 kg.

The CUPRA Born blends sharp, athletic styling with a playful electric character, delivering hatchback agility and hot-hatch attitude whether you're darting through the city or cruising the open road. Inside, the cabin punches above its weight with smart materials and practical space, making it a compelling pick for buyers who want electric motoring without surrendering the grin.
detailsThe Toyota Corolla Cross takes the familiar Corolla recipe, lifts it up and dresses it in SUV clothes — sensible, comfortable and blessedly unflashy. It won’t thrill the enthusiast, but its easy manners, clever packaging and dependable feel make it an ideal everyday car for shoppers who prefer sense over sass.
